MACROMEDIA COLDFUSION 4.5-CFML LANGUAGE Reference page 232

Cfml language reference
Table of Contents

Advertisement

208
PROVIDERDSN
Optional. Data source name for the COM provider (OLE-DB only).
DEBUG
Optional. Yes or No. Specifies whether debug info will be listed on each statement.
Default is No.
RETURNCODE
Optional. Yes or No. Specifies whether the tag populates
CFSTOREDPROC.STATUSCODE with the status code returned by the stored
procedure. Default is No.
Usage
Within a CFSTOREDPROC tag, you code
necessary.
If you set the ReturnCode parameter to "YES", CFSTOREDPROC sets a variable called
CFSTOREDPROC.STATUSCODE, which indicates the status code for the stored
procedure. Stored procedure status code values vary by DBMS. Refer to your DBMS-
specific documentation for the meaning of individual status code values.
In addition to returning a status code, CFSTOREDPROC sets a variable called
CFSTOREDPROC.ExecutionTime. This variable contains the number of milliseconds
that it took the stored procedure to execute.
Stored procedures represent an advanced feature, found in high-end database
management systems. You should be familiar with stored procedures and their usage
before implementing these tags.
Example
...
<!--- The following example executes a Sybase stored procedure
<!--- CFSTOREDPROC tag --->
<CFSTOREDPROC PROCEDURE="foo_proc"
DATASOURCE="MY_SYBASE_TEST"USERNAME="sa"
PASSWORD=""DBSERVER="scup"DBNAME="pubs2"
RETURNCODE="YES"DEBUG>
<!--- CFPROCRESULT tags --->
<CFPROCRESULT NAME = RS1>
<CFPROCRESULT NAME = RS3 RESULTSET = 3>
<!---
<CFPROCPARAM TYPE="IN"
CFSQLTYPE=CF_SQL_INTEGER
<CFPROCPARAM TYPE="OUT"CFSQLTYPE=CF_SQL_DATE
VARIABLE=FOO DBVARNAME=@param2>
<!--- Close the CFSTOREDPROC tag --->
</CFSTOREDPROC>
<CFOUTPUT>
that returns three result sets, two of which we want. The
stored procedure returns the status code and one output
parameter, which we display. We use named notation
for the parameters. --->
CFPROCPARAM tags --->
VALUE="1"DBVARNAME=@param1>
CFML Language Reference
CFPROCRESULT
and
CFPROCPARAM
tags as

Advertisement

Table of Contents
loading
Need help?

Need help?

Do you have a question about the COLDFUSION 4.5-CFML LANGUAGE and is the answer not in the manual?

Questions and answers

Subscribe to Our Youtube Channel

This manual is also suitable for:

Coldfusion 4.5

Table of Contents